Course Details

Introduction to Cybersecurity for Smart Cities: Understanding the cybersecurity landscape and challenges in the context of smart cities.
Cyber Threats and Vulnerabilities: Identifying and analyzing common cyber threats and vulnerabilities in smart city infrastructure.
Cybersecurity Framework for Smart Cities: Implementing a comprehensive cybersecurity framework to protect critical infrastructure.
Identity and Access Management: Managing user identities and access controls to ensure secure access to smart city systems.
Data Privacy and Protection: Protecting citizens' personal data and ensuring compliance with data privacy regulations.
Incident Response and Disaster Recovery: Developing incident response plans and disaster recovery procedures for smart city systems.
Cybersecurity Best Practices: Adopting best practices for secure software development, network design, and system configuration.
Cybersecurity Awareness and Training: Training smart city officials and employees on cybersecurity awareness and threat intelligence.
Emerging Technologies and Cybersecurity: Understanding the impact of emerging technologies such as AI, IoT, and 5G on smart city cybersecurity.

Cybersecurity Analysts take up the largest portion of the cybersecurity workforce, with 35% of the smart city officials in this role. Their responsibilities include monitoring networks for security breaches, investigating security incidents, and recommending security enhancements. Security Engineers, who make up 25% of the workforce, are responsible for implementing and maintaining security systems, as well as responding to security incidents. Security Managers, accounting for 20% of the workforce, oversee the development and implementation of an organisation's security policies and procedures, and ensure compliance. Ethical Hackers, also known as white-hat hackers, represent 10% of the workforce. They use their skills to identify vulnerabilities in systems and applications before malicious hackers do. Finally, Chief Information Security Officers (CISOs) also account for 10% of the workforce. They are responsible for the overall information and data security strategy within an organisation.
